Read MoreMayor Ted Wheeler accuses troops of “sharply escalating” protest-related violence.Mayor Ted Wheeler accuses troops of “sharply escalating” protest-related violence.
Terms of Use
Read MoreMayor Ted Wheeler accuses troops of “sharply escalating” protest-related violence.Mayor Ted Wheeler accuses troops of “sharply escalating” protest-related violence.